The Determination Of Nitrite In Food And Sensitivity Enhancement With Cyclodextrins | | Posted on:2009-02-07 | Degree:Master | Type:Thesis | | Country:China | Candidate:Y X Guo | Full Text:PDF | | GTID:2121360242486543 | Subject:Food Science | | Abstract/Summary: | PDF Full Text Request | | It is known that nitrite is wide spread contaminants of food,soil and surface water worldwide.The determination of nitrite and nitrate is of general importance because of their harmful impact on human health.The toxicity of nitrite is primarily due to the fact that it can react with secondary or tertiary amines present in human body to form nitrosamines,and nitrite can react with iron(Ⅲ) of haemoglobin to produce methaemoglobinaemia disease.Thus,the determination of nitrite is of great importance.Cyclodextrin(CD) has influence on optics property of guest-object,such as how to enhance selectivity and stability of methods,and how to increase sensitivity and decrease detection limit.The researches for the determination of nitrite in food and sensitivity enhancement with cyclodextrins in this thesis included four aspects:(1) The fluorescence of o-phenylenediamine is very weak,but when it reacts with nitrite in an acidic medium,a strong fluorescence triazole- benzotriazole forms in alkaline medium.The sensitivity is largely enhanced in the presence of CD because of complexation,and the effect of HP-β-Cyclodextrin(HP-β-CD) was most effective.(2) A rapid,sensitive spectrophotometric determination of nitrite using new diazotizing and coupling reagents is described.The method is based on a diazotion-coupling reaction between benzidine and hydrochloric acid-naphthyl-ethylenediamine in a hydrochloric acid medium.This increase in absorbance is directly proportional to nitrite concentration obeying Beer's law.(3) A new fluorescence quenching method has been developed to determine nitrite in water and food samples.The method is based on the reaction between nitrite and the water-soluble dye phenosafranine(PS), which is used as an emission reagent,to form a non-fluorescent compound in hydrochloric acid.The sensitivity is largely enhanced in the presence of CD because of complexation.HP-β-CD was most effective.(4) A simple and sensitive spectrophotometric method for the determination of nitrite is described.The method is based on the oxidation of brilliant cresyl blue by nitrite in acidic solution,which resulted in the decrease in absorbance at 636 nm.The sensitivity is largely enhanced in the presence ofβ-CD because of inclusion complexation. | | Keywords/Search Tags: | o-phenylenediamine, Nitrite, β-cyclodextrin, Benzidine, Phenosafranine, Brilliant cresyl blue | PDF Full Text Request | Related items |
